The secret? A little terracotta jar

It's called an olla (pronounced "oya"). It's a little terracotta jar you bury in the pot and fill with water. Because terracotta is porous, it lets through just the right amount of water, exactly when the plant needs it. No batteries, no app, no plug. Magic? No: clever.
